What is the Boots Smooth Skin hair remover?
The Boots Smooth Skin hair removal system is a small laser machine which is designed for home use. It uses iPulse Hair Reduction Technology and is a mini version of the machines which are used in salons. The machine consists of a base unit and hand held laser which must be connected to mains electricity. It’s only 24cm tall by 18cm wide in size and comes complete with a smart cream colored storage vanity case.
What is IPL?
Intense Pulse Light Therapy (IPL) is an advanced form of light-based beauty therapy which can be used to permanently remove hair. By generating a short, intense pulse of filtered light into the skin, the colored pigments around the hair absorb the light, which disables the hair follicle, preventing further re-growth.
Who can use it?
Unfortunately, the system isn’t suitable for everyone. Because the light pulses work best on dark hair follicles growing from a fair skinned person, this makes it unsuitable for those with very fair, red, grey or white hair. It also rules out those who are dark skinned or with a suntan. However, if you are a light skinned person with blond hair, but have darker hair in places you’d rather not, you could use this system.
Where on the body can it be used?
You can use the iPulse system to remove hair from any part of the body where there is hair growth. However, you are strongly recommended not to use it on areas such as the head or eyebrows, as hair will not grow back! Ideally, it’s best used on the legs, underarms, bikini line and darker facial hair.
